Ruling Text

NY E84519 July 28, 1999 CLA-2-63:RR:NC:TA:352 E84519 CATEGORY: Classification TARIFF NO.: 6307.90.9989 Ms. Joanne Balice CBI Distributing Corp. 2400 W. Central Rd. Hoffman Estates, IL 60195-1930 RE: The tariff classification of a basket from China. Dear Ms. Balice: In your letter dated June 28, 1999, you requested a tariff classification ruling. The sample submitted is a basket, style number 7488. It is used as a shopping basket in stores for customers to hold small items they are purchasing. The basket is tubular shaped. The sides are constructed of 100 percent polyester open work knit fabric. The bottom is made of woven nylon fabric. Sewn into the bottom and top edges is a plastic tube. It features a braided textile cord carry handle inserted through a plastic tube. The applicable subheading for the basket will be 6307.90.9989, Harmonized Tariff Schedule of the United States (HTS), which provides for other made up articles . . . Other. The rate of duty will be 7 percent ad valorem. This ruling is being issued under the provisions of Part 177 of the Customs Regulations (19 C.F.R. 177). A copy of the ruling or the control number indicated above should be provided with the entry documents filed at the time this merchandise is imported.
